Senior Director of Operations- Kenson Plastics
As our Senior Director of Operations, you will step in as a vital leader to drive manufacturing excellence, strategic planning, and continuous improvement across every operational facet.

This role requires a hands-on, visionary strategist who can scale production capabilities, champion innovative plastics manufacturing processes, and ensure shop-floor execution directly aligns with our broader business trajectory. We are looking for an execution-focused leader with a proven background in custom plastics or advanced manufacturing environments who excels at optimizing supply chain workflows, elevating product quality, and cultivating a high-performance culture rooted in accountability and safety.

This is an onsite role in our Beaver Falls facility.
